Abstract
A powertrain includes a variable ratio transmission device having an input shaft coupled to an engine and an output shaft coupled to a driven unit, a three-way power split transmission device including three input/output couplings, a first of which is coupled to a flywheel and a second of which is coupled to an electrical machine. The third input/output coupling of the three way power split transmission device is mechanically coupled to the engine and to the input shaft of the variable ratio transmission device.
